2. The George Rogers Clark National Historical Park Trail

Embedded within the symbolic heart of Vincennes lies the George Rogers Clark National Historical Park, an ethereal homage to the valor of American Revolutionary War hero George Rogers Clark. The trail meanders around a historical site that houses the impressive monument, towering majestically, akin to a sentinel overseeing a rich legacy. Hiking here transcends mere exercise; it becomes a pilgrimage through time, allowing hikers to resonate with the courage and determination of those who once tread these grounds.

The flat, paved paths ensure accessibility, making this a perfect location for families and individuals alike. As visitors traverse the trail, they encounter interpretive signs peppered throughout, each narrating critical episodes from history, thus intertwining the physical journey with an educational exploration. 3. The Vincennes Riverwalk

In stark contrast to the rugged terrain of traditional hiking paths, the Vincennes Riverwalk is an elegant promenade that blends urban sophistication with natural splendour. This leisurely trail, stretching alongside the Wabash River, embodies the essence of leisurely exploration, akin to a stroll through an art gallery, where nature is the curator. The Riverwalk’s smooth surfaces make it ideal for walking, jogging, and cycling, inviting a diverse array of visitors to revel in the riverside aesthetic.
